What is an "Unlocked" phone?
Many cell phones are designed to use a Subscriber Identity Module (SIM) card to store subscriber data. These SIM cards are issued by the carrier and provide cell service to the phone. "Locked" cell phones will only recognize SIM cards from the carrier that originally provided the phone. Almost every cell phone provided by a US carrier is locked to that carrier’s network.
"Unlocked" cell phones will recognize SIM cards from any carrier using Global System Mobile Communications (GSM) technology. Customers with "unlocked" cell phones are able to use any GSM carrier of their choosing, including "pre-pay" or "no contract" SIM card options. "Unlocked" cell phones also accept international SIM cards that provide discounted rates while traveling abroad.
